Foundation Crack Repair Services
Foundation crack repair involves identifying and sealing cracks that develop in the concrete or masonry foundation of a property. These repairs typically start with a thorough inspection to determine the size, location, and cause of the cracks. Once assessed, contractors may use various methods such as epoxy injections, polyurethane foam, or carbon fiber reinforcement to stabilize and seal the cracks. The goal is to prevent further deterioration, water intrusion, and structural issues that can compromise the safety and stability of the building.
Cracks in foundations often result from soil movement, settling, or changes in moisture levels around the property. Left unaddressed, these issues can lead to u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, and more severe structural damage over time. Foundation crack repair services help mitigate these problems by restoring the integrity of the foundation and preventing the progression of existing damage. Proper repair can also reduce the risk of water leaks, mold growth, and interior damage caused by moisture infiltration through cracks.
Properties that commonly require foundation crack repair include residential homes, especially those with basements or crawl spaces, as well as commercial buildings with concrete or masonry foundations. Older properties may be more prone to cracking due to natural settling, while newer constructions might experience cracks from construction-related stresses or soil shifts. Foundation Crack Repair Costs - The typical cost for foundation crack repair services ranges from $500 to $2,500, depending on the severity and size of the cracks. For example, minor cracks may cost around $500, while more extensive repairs can reach $2,500 or more.
Material and Method Expenses - Expenses vary based on the repair materials and techniques used, with prices generally between $300 and $2,000. Epoxy injections might cost around $1,000, whereas carbon fiber reinforcement could be closer to $2,000.
Size and Severity Factors - Larger or more severe cracks typically incur higher costs, often ranging from $1,000 to $4,000. Small, hairline cracks tend to stay under $1,000, while significant structural issues can push costs upward.
Location and Accessibility - Repair costs are influenced by the location and accessibility of the foundation, with services in Naperville, IL, generally falling within $1,000 to $3,000. Difficult-to-reach areas may increase labor costs and overall expenses.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es foundation cracks? Foundation cracks can result from soil movement, settling, or moisture changes around the property.
Are all foundation cracks a sign of serious problems? Not all cracks indicate structural issues; some may be minor. A professional assessment can determine the severity.
How do professionals repair foundation cracks? Repair methods vary from sealing small cracks to epoxy injections and foundation underpinning, depending on the extent of damage.
How long does foundation crack repair typically take? The duration depends on the repair method and extent of damage, but many repairs can be completed within a few days.
Is foundation crack repair a DIY project? Foundation repairs are complex and best handled by experienced contractors to ensure proper and lasting results.
